PM - lunchtime - I ran on the treadmill as the outside temperature seemed way too hot.  Glad I did.  I also wore the HR monitor for the first time in a while and decided to keep the pace in HR Zone 3 - as I think I may be doing some of my easy runs too hard.  Indeed I sometimes get impatient on runs and will pick up the pace just to get them completed faster.  I think this was a good idea - as I kept the pace pretty steady at 7:30-7:35 and had an avg HR of 137 for the 7 miles I ran.  Felt somewhat rested and less drained afterwards.

AM -  Hotel in DC gave me a free pass to a Bally's Fitness club as they did not have their own fitness room - and because it was raining, I decided to use it for my workout this morning.  Had a surprisingly excellent workout - love when that happens unexpectedly.  2 mile warm up and cool down - with 4 x 10 mins at 6:24 pace (1% grade on theTM) with 2 min rest between each.  I would have to say this is the first time in this build-up that I was well in control and not overly stressed at this pace.  Felt very good, and could have easily punched up the pace a bit or gone longer for each of the workbouts.  Quite pleased with how I felt - especially since I have have been having a number of workouts where I have not felt very fit or strong.  Maybe the base training is finally starting to pay off.

PM - in Auckland, New Zealand 4 miles rather quickly at close to 7 min pace and then 4 miles at threshold (6:25) pace or better along the water (Hobson Bay) in very cool temps in the 40's.  Had a long day of travel yesterday from Melbourne with a 3 hour time difference in NZ - putting us 17 hours ahead of US Eastern time - we arrived after midnight, took a hotel near the airport and then with only a few hours sleep headed to our offices in Whangarei NZ (pronounced with an "F" sound so it is "Fon Gar Ay") and then back around 4 pm in enough time for a run.  Would have loved to go further south to Nelson to see the US match in World Cup Rugby but it would have been too tight of a schedule and besides, I would have missed a great run.

PM - 8.0 miles in and around a jungle outside of downtown Singapore - a technical trail run with twists, turns, hills, rocks, roots, monkeys, crocs (or something like a croc) and plenty of heat and humidity.  Actually got turned around and ran further than planned, but it was a good workout to wear me out before my long flight home tonight to help me sleep.  If I could figure out how to post a video or photos on this blog - there was a very unexpected moment where a monkey came up and took Richie's drink bottle and opened it for himself as we were taking photos.  Really interesting experience.
